About Лей Ма
Лей Ма is a scholar working on Computer Graphics and Computer-Aided Design, Acoustics and Ultrasonics, Computer Vision and Pattern Recognition, Aging and Virology, having authored 168 papers that have together received 1.4k indexed citations. Recurring topics across this work include Influenza Virus Research Studies (14 papers), Computer Graphics and Visualization Techniques (13 papers), Advanced Vision and Imaging (12 papers), Viral gastroenteritis research and epidemiology (11 papers), Image Enhancement Techniques (10 papers), Quantum Information and Cryptography (9 papers), Advanced Memory and Neural Computing (8 papers) and Robotics and Sensor-Based Localization (7 papers). The work is most often cited by research in Acoustics and Ultrasonics (18 citations), Aging (29 citations), Computer Graphics and Computer-Aided Design (43 citations), Computer Vision and Pattern Recognition (239 citations) and Metals and Alloys (29 citations). Лей Ма has collaborated with scholars based in China, United States and Singapore. Frequent co-authors include Yun Li, Tiejun Huang, Guoxiang Huang, Yang Liu, Chao Hang, Dong‐Ming Yan, Dirmanto Jap, Xiaolu Hou, Jakub Breier and Shivam Bhasin. Their work appears in journals such as Human Vaccines & Immunotherapeutics, Nature Computational Science, Journal of Medical Virology, Vaccine and Applied Physics B.
